Subject: Cron jobs → Loomflow, done-ish

Hi release folks — as of today, all the nightly cron jobs on the Pinewick boxes have been ported to the Loomflow engine. Old crontabs are commented out, not deleted, in case we need a quick rollback. Future maintainers: everything schedules from Loomflow now. The migration build is identified by the token below.

build token for yajof-bajof: htk31_506ff1188f74596b5bb2eec94edc43c

# Cold storage archiver — Norbeck bucket sweep.
# Welcome aboard. This job moves buckets untouched for 180+ days into
# the Glacierline tier. ARCHIVE_DRY_RUN defaults to true; leave it that
# way until your first reviewed run. Lifecycle rules live in the policy
# repo, not here — don't edit them inline. The archiver authenticates
# to the storage gateway with a key, set on the following line.

sealed setting: ARCHIVE_KEY3=8d0

Subject: FeeForge cut-over complete

Cut-over to the new shipping-fee rules engine finished last night. Old engine is read-only until end of quarter, then decommissioned. All zone-based rules migrated; three legacy promo rules were dropped deliberately — see the migration notes. Shadow-mode comparison ran two weeks with under 0.1% divergence, all rounding. If fees look wrong, check rule precedence first, not rates. For reference, the engine went live with the following settings.

deployment values, kajep-kageg:
[praix]
host = praix.paliqcorp.corp
user = praix_svc
database = praix_prod

## Approvals: Websocket Reconnect Fix

This page tracks sign-off for the patch addressing the reconnect storm in the Pondbridge gateway, where dropped websocket sessions retried without backoff and overwhelmed the edge nodes. The fix adds jittered exponential backoff and caps concurrent reconnect attempts per client. QA has verified behavior under simulated network flaps, and load testing passed on staging. Before we schedule the rollout, we need one final approval per our change policy. The approver responsible for this change is named below.

account owner for tawip-kahop: Oliok Jorix Ulaath Quenok